TOL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

400 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Toll Brothers (TOL)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$4.29B — up 9.2% from $3.92B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 75 funds opened new TOL positions and 55 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 122 added to existing stakes and 153 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Massachusetts Financial Services, adding an estimated $53.8M. The largest seller was Fidelity International, exiting entirely with an estimated $122M sold.
